Solidarity is focus of Minnesota Union Women's Retreat

More than 120 women, some getting involved in the labor movement for the first time, came together April 24-26 for the Minnesota Union Women's Retreat. Held at Ruttger's Bay Lake Lodge and Conference Center near Brainerd, the retreat provided an...»


Project on Capitol construction takes researchers around the state

A groundbreaking project to uncover the stories of the people who built the Minnesota state Capitol has taken researchers not only to downtown St. Paul, but also to Kasota, St. Cloud, Winona and numerous communities around the state....»

Help Us Find the Workers who Built the Minnesota Capitol

The "Who Built the Capitol?" project is off and running. David Riehle, experienced local labor historian, has plunged into the archives at the Minnesota History Center and the Minnesota State Capitol to find original sources about the workers who participated...»
